News

David Coulthard believes it is “bizarre” that George Russell does not yet have a contract for the 2026 season, with Mercedes ...
Former F1 driver Juan Pablo Montoya suspects Max Verstappen may have already signed with Mercedes after allegedly meeting ...
Lewis Hamilton holds the record for race victories in F1, but a few circuits have eluded him in his career, including three on the current schedule.